Analysis
Cook Islands recorded 6 for how many health warnings are approved by the law for smokeless in 2022. That is the highest value across all 8 years on record.
Compared with earlier readings it is unchanged over ten years.
Over the whole period, how many health warnings are approved by the law for smokeless in Cook Islands peaked at 6 in 2008 and was at its lowest, 6, in 2008.
Cook Islands ranks 18th of 104 countries on this measure, in the top quarter.
